Description

In a world where the existence of extraterrestrial beings is a deeply debated topic, this narrative delves into the complexities of human-alien interactions. The story unfolds through multiple perspectives, showcasing individuals grappling with fear, curiosity, and misunderstanding as they confront the reality of otherworldly visitors. Some characters embrace their alien counterparts, recognizing the potential for collaboration and learning, while others remain steadfast in their skepticism, convinced of impending danger.

The narrative takes readers on a journey through various encounters, revealing how different societies react to the knowledge of extraterrestrial life. These interactions spark a range of emotions—fascination, dread, and even compassion—illustrating that the truth about these visitors is far from black and white. It explores the idea that not all beings from the cosmos come with malicious intent; some are simply seeking refuge or understanding.

As the characters navigate their encounters, they are forced to confront their own prejudices and fears, forcing them to reconsider what it means to coexist with those who are different. The book encapsulates the essence of humanity's quest for connection and understanding, while also inviting readers to ponder their own views on the unknown.
